I see your point. But you may go overboard in asserting that ANY effort to restrain a young child's exuberant behavior is demeaning or emotionally crippling. Skillfully done, parental curbs on exuberance can gradually, in age-sensitive ways, lead children to recognize that they need to respect others' "space," especially in public places.
